Book excerpt: Mixtures of cyanogen and oxygen diluted in argon were ignited behind reflected shocks in a single-pulse shock tube. The ignition delay times were determined from pressure observations. The experiments covered the temperature range 1400 K to 2000 K. This range permitted ignition delay times from 15 to 430 microseconds. Eight mixture groups and their initial conditions were chosen in such a manner that the influence of each particular parameter on the induction period would be unequivocally evaluated. The resulting equation for induction time was determined. Product distribution before and after ignition was determined by mass spectroscopy. Results indicated that the combustion of cyanogen is thermodynamically controlled. Hydrogen lowers activation energy and shortens induction time. This indicates that with the addition of H2 a chain branching mechanism becomes rate controlling. Modified author abstract).

Book excerpt: A detailed study was made of ignition delay times in ethane-oxygen-argon mixtures behind a reflected shock wave as indicated by pressure and light emission observation. Measured induction times ranged from 20-600 microsec over a temperature interval of 1235 - 1660K and associated pressures of from 2-8 atm. To elucidate composition effects, the equivalence ratio of the test mixture were varied from 0.5 - 2.0 in approximately 95% dilution with argon. (Author).

Book excerpt: The ignition of propane-oxygen mixtures highly diluted with argon has been examined in the region behind a reflected shock wave in a single pulse shock tube. The measurements covered a temperature range of 1250-1600K at pressures varying from 2 to 10 atmospheres for mixture equivalence ratios of 0.125 to 2.0. For these conditions, observed induction times ranged from 12 to 600 microseconds. In one series of tests on a stoichiometric mixture, analyses were made of the shocked gas just prior to and immediately after ignition. These revealed that extensive pyrolysis of the propane preceded ignition. Mixture compositions and test conditions in this investigation were selected in such a manner that the influence of significant parameters on the ignition delay times could be clearly delineated. It was found that the experimental results of more than 150 tests were well correlated. (Author).

Book excerpt: Detailed one-dimensional calculations have been performed to simulate weak and strong ignition in reflected shock tube experiments in hydrogen-oxygen-argon mixtures. It is found that the experiment and simulations agree well in the strong ignition case studied. In the weak ignition case, the simulations show the same qualitative behavior as the experiment. Here ignition starts at a distance away from the reflecting wall at a time much earlier than the calculated chemical induction time. This latter effect is shown to arise because of the sensitivity of the chemical induction time to fluctuations in the calculation. In the calculations these fluctuations arise from small numerical inaccuracies. In experiments, they can arise from a number of sources including nonuniformities in the incident shock wave leading to non-uniform reflection, thermal conduction to the walls, and interactions with boundary layers. Available in PDF, EPUB and Kindle. Book excerpt: The ignition times of Propene Oxygen Argon mixtures were measured in a shock tube. The concentrations ranged from 0.6% to 1.6% C3H6 and 2.7% to 14.4% oxygen. The initial pressures were 50 to 133 torr, and the temperatures achieved were 1274-1848 K. The overall ignition delay equation for Propene Oxygen Argon mixtures has a value of tau = 5.3 x 10 to the minus 14th power exp((37.5 x 10 to 3rd power)/RT)(C3H6) 0.23 (O2) -1.12 (Ar)0 sec. A kinetic scheme for the oxidation of propene is proposed.
